Militant Killed Feeripora Shopian Gunfight: Police

Srinagar, Oct 12 : Police on Tuesday said that an unidentified militant was killed in a gunfight with joint team of police, army and CRPF at Feeripora area of Shopian. The firefight had ensured hours after the culmination of an overnight gunfight in the south Kashmir district’s Tulran area in which three militants were killed.

“One unidentified (militant) killed. Operation (is) going on. Further details shall follow,”a police spokesman said in a tweet. The cordon-and-searches in the area were launched late last evening, sources told GNS.

Earlier police said three militants were killed in the overnight gunfight with joint team of police, army and CRPF at Tulran area of the district.

Inspector General of Police Kashmir Vijay Kumar on official Twitter handle said that out of three militants killed; one has been identified as Mukhtar Shah of Ganderbal who he said shifted to Shopian after killing “one street hawker Virendra Paswan of Bihar.” (GNS)
